2. Supports Oral Health
Dental implants promote healthier outcomes compared to other restorative treatments. Because they do not require reducing or reshaping adjacent teeth, implants preserve your natural tooth structure. They also act as artificial roots, which stimulate the jawbone and prevent the bone loss that often follows tooth loss. Preserving bone density is important for keeping the facial structure intact and maintaining oral function over time. Patients also notice that surrounding teeth remain stable, reducing the likelihood of shifting or misalignment that can complicate future care.
3. Increases Longevity and Durability
Unlike removable restorations, dental implants are designed to last for decades with the right care. Made from biocompatible titanium, the implant post fuses with the jawbone to create a strong and permanent foundation. When paired with good oral hygiene habits such as brushing, flossing, and regular professional cleanings, implants often last a lifetime. Their long-term value makes them a practical investment in both health and appearance. While bridges and dentures may require periodic replacements, implants often remain secure and functional for many years without the need for adjustments.
4. Improves Daily Functionality
Patients quickly notice the difference in comfort and function after choosing implants. Because they are anchored securely in the jaw, dental implants eliminate the shifting, clicking, or slipping that can happen with removable dentures. This stability allows you to eat your favorite foods, speak clearly, and smile freely without hesitation. For example, patients often report enjoying foods like apples, corn, or steak again without worry. The confidence that comes with this comfort can positively influence daily routines and overall lifestyle, offering freedom that other restorative treatments sometimes cannot provide.
